Importance of Green Hydrogen for Türkiye

Green hydrogen is hydrogen produced using electrical energy obtained from renewable energy sources (wind, solar, hydraulic, biomass, etc.). Hydrogen is gaining increasing attention in the energy sector worldwide as a zero-emission fuel source. Therefore, the production of green hydrogen is considered a sustainable energy source and plays an important role in the fight against climate change. Turkey also has a significant potential for the production and use of green hydrogen.

Turkey is one of the countries with the highest solar energy potential in the world and also has renewable energy resources such as wind energy, hydraulic energy, geothermal energy. These resources provide a suitable environment for Turkey’s green hydrogen production.
It is thought that green hydrogen will reduce dependence on fossil fuels, reduce air pollution and contribute to the fight against global warming. By using this potential, Turkey can make green hydrogen a priority fuel source in energy production, and as a result, it can gain significant benefits both economically and environmentally.

  • The world’s need for green hydrogen is very high. By this means, Türkiye is a candidate to become a very important player in the hydrogen market. Renewable energy and water are the two important resources required for this. Turkey, which has almost all types of renewable energy, is surrounded by sea on three sides and has underground and running waters, is a candidate country to convert these resources into added value, namely hydrogen, and become one of the largest hydrogen exporters in the world.
  • It will be able to transform the surplus electricity production into added value and financial opportunity with hydrogen production.

Türkiye will increase this hydrogen conversion and hydrogen economy opportunity and its technological capabilities.

Turkey is in a position to export the green hydrogen it produces using domestic energy resources. The ports in the country offer a suitable infrastructure for hydrogen export. Turkey’s geographical location allows it to access both European and Asian markets.
Turkey is preparing for the hydrogen economy. The country is taking a series of measures in order to increase its domestic production and to develop technologies that can be used in hydrogen production. In this context, Turkey aims to develop hydrogen technologies such as the electrolyzer that can be used in domestic hydrogen production.

In Turkey, “Regulation on Green Hydrogen Production and Use” was published in 2020. With this regulation, issues such as licensing the facilities used in the production of green hydrogen, quality standards of green hydrogen and monitoring the environmental effects of the facilities are regulated. These regulations create a suitable environment for the production and use of green hydrogen and help Turkey to evaluate its green hydrogen potential.

In the prepared 12th Development Plan (2024-2028) and MENR 2024-2028 Strategic Plan, the hydrogen issue will be handled as a priority, and targets in this direction are included.

According to the “Turkey Hydrogen Technologies Strategy and Roadmap” announced by the Ministry of Energy and Natural Resources (MENR) on January 19, 2023, as the latest study on this subject;

  • Reducing the cost of green hydrogen production below 2.4 US/kgH2 by 2035 and below 1.2 US/kgH2 by 2053,
  • The targets for the installed power capacity of the electrolyzer to reach 2 GW in 2030, 5 GW in 2035 and 70 GW in 2053 have been announced.

Green Hydrogen production and use; Considering Turkey’s dependence on energy imports, it will make a significant contribution to energy independence. In addition, green hydrogen production will contribute to new job opportunities and economic growth.
